• 0216 488 01 91
  • destek@sonsuzbilgi.com.tr

Avukat Web Siteniz Yok mu?

Hemen bugün bir Avukat Web Siteniz Olsun, Web'in gücünü keşfedin.

SSL Sertifikası + Sınırsız İçerik + Full SEO Uyumlu + Full Mobil Uyumlu.
Üstelik İsterseniz Yapay Zeka Hukuk Asistanı Seçeneğiyle


Şablon Literal'ları ve Template Strings Kullanımı

Adı : Şablon Literal'ları ve Template Strings Kullanımı

Şablon Literal'ları ve Template Strings Kullanımı
Şablon Literal'ları JavaScript'te 2015 yılında ECMAScript 6 (ES6) ile tanıtılan bir özelliktir. Şablon literal'ları, daha önceki JavaScript sürümlerindeki stringlerden farklı olarak, birkaç farklı özelliği içermektedir. Bu özelliklerden en önemlisi, string içindeki değişkenleri ifade edebilmesidir. Bu özellik sayesinde, daha önce kullanılan uzun string birleştirmeleri yerine daha okunaklı ve daha basit kodlar yazılabilir.
Template Strings ise, Şablon Literal'ları'nın kullanımını kolaylaştıran ve daha okunaklı hale getiren özel bir yazım şeklidir. Template Strings ile bir string, arka arkaya yazılmış normal bir string gibi değil, ters tırnak (backtick) ile yazılır. Bu sayede, string içinde özel karakterler kullanmak yerine, değişkenleri doğrudan içine ekleyebiliriz.
Şablon Literal'ları ve Template Strings kullanımı hakkında birkaç örnek verelim:
1. Değişken Ekleme:
Geleneksel yöntem:
var ad = \"John\";
var soyad = \"Doe\";
console.log(\"My name is \" + ad + \" \" + soyad);
Şablon Literal'ları kullanarak:
const ad = \"John\";
const soyad = \"Doe\";
console.log(`My name is ${ad} ${soyad}`);
Template Strings kullanarak:
const ad = \"John\";
const soyad = \"Doe\";
console.log(`My name is ${ad} ${soyad}`);
2. Matematiksel İşlemler:
Geleneksel yöntem:
var x = 10;
var y = 5;
console.log(\"Toplam \" + (x + y));
Şablon Literal'ları kullanarak:
const x = 10;
const y = 5;
console.log(`Toplam ${x + y}`);
Template Strings kullanarak:
const x = 10;
const y = 5;
console.log(`Toplam ${x + y}`);
3. Koşullu İşlemler:
Geleneksel yöntem:
var x = 10;
if (x > 5) {
console.log(\"x 5'ten büyüktür\");
}
Şablon Literal'ları kullanarak:
const x = 10;
if (x > 5) {
console.log(`x 5'ten büyüktür`);
}
Template Strings kullanarak:
const x = 10;
if (x > 5) {
console.log(`x 5'ten büyüktür`);
}
Sık Sorulan Sorular:
Soru: Şablon Literal'larına benzer bir özellik var mıdır?
Cevap: Şablon Literal'ları, JavaScript ile gelen benzersiz bir özelliktir. Buna benzer bir özellik yoktur.
Soru: Şablon Literal'ları, kodun okunaklığını artırır mı?
Cevap: Evet, Şablon Literal'ları kodun okunaklığını artırır. Değişkenleri doğrudan string içine eklememizi sağlar, bu da kodun daha anlaşılır olmasını ve daha az hata yapmayı mümkün kılar.
Soru: Template Strings, eski JavaScript sürümleriyle uyumlu mu?
Cevap: Template Strings, yalnızca ECMAScript 6 ve sonraki sürümlerde mevcuttur. Eski JavaScript sürümleriyle uyumlu değiller.

Şablon Literal'ları ve Template Strings Kullanımı

Adı : Şablon Literal'ları ve Template Strings Kullanımı

Şablon Literal'ları ve Template Strings Kullanımı
Şablon Literal'ları JavaScript'te 2015 yılında ECMAScript 6 (ES6) ile tanıtılan bir özelliktir. Şablon literal'ları, daha önceki JavaScript sürümlerindeki stringlerden farklı olarak, birkaç farklı özelliği içermektedir. Bu özelliklerden en önemlisi, string içindeki değişkenleri ifade edebilmesidir. Bu özellik sayesinde, daha önce kullanılan uzun string birleştirmeleri yerine daha okunaklı ve daha basit kodlar yazılabilir.
Template Strings ise, Şablon Literal'ları'nın kullanımını kolaylaştıran ve daha okunaklı hale getiren özel bir yazım şeklidir. Template Strings ile bir string, arka arkaya yazılmış normal bir string gibi değil, ters tırnak (backtick) ile yazılır. Bu sayede, string içinde özel karakterler kullanmak yerine, değişkenleri doğrudan içine ekleyebiliriz.
Şablon Literal'ları ve Template Strings kullanımı hakkında birkaç örnek verelim:
1. Değişken Ekleme:
Geleneksel yöntem:
var ad = \"John\";
var soyad = \"Doe\";
console.log(\"My name is \" + ad + \" \" + soyad);
Şablon Literal'ları kullanarak:
const ad = \"John\";
const soyad = \"Doe\";
console.log(`My name is ${ad} ${soyad}`);
Template Strings kullanarak:
const ad = \"John\";
const soyad = \"Doe\";
console.log(`My name is ${ad} ${soyad}`);
2. Matematiksel İşlemler:
Geleneksel yöntem:
var x = 10;
var y = 5;
console.log(\"Toplam \" + (x + y));
Şablon Literal'ları kullanarak:
const x = 10;
const y = 5;
console.log(`Toplam ${x + y}`);
Template Strings kullanarak:
const x = 10;
const y = 5;
console.log(`Toplam ${x + y}`);
3. Koşullu İşlemler:
Geleneksel yöntem:
var x = 10;
if (x > 5) {
console.log(\"x 5'ten büyüktür\");
}
Şablon Literal'ları kullanarak:
const x = 10;
if (x > 5) {
console.log(`x 5'ten büyüktür`);
}
Template Strings kullanarak:
const x = 10;
if (x > 5) {
console.log(`x 5'ten büyüktür`);
}
Sık Sorulan Sorular:
Soru: Şablon Literal'larına benzer bir özellik var mıdır?
Cevap: Şablon Literal'ları, JavaScript ile gelen benzersiz bir özelliktir. Buna benzer bir özellik yoktur.
Soru: Şablon Literal'ları, kodun okunaklığını artırır mı?
Cevap: Evet, Şablon Literal'ları kodun okunaklığını artırır. Değişkenleri doğrudan string içine eklememizi sağlar, bu da kodun daha anlaşılır olmasını ve daha az hata yapmayı mümkün kılar.
Soru: Template Strings, eski JavaScript sürümleriyle uyumlu mu?
Cevap: Template Strings, yalnızca ECMAScript 6 ve sonraki sürümlerde mevcuttur. Eski JavaScript sürümleriyle uyumlu değiller.


Ankara Plaket İmalatı

Tüm Plaket ihtiyaçlarınız için Buradayız!

Kristal, Ahşap, Bayrak.. Plaket ihtiyaçlarınıza Mükemmel çözümler üretiyoruz.


Şablon Literalleri Template Strings Kullanımı Strings Değişkenler JavaScript ES6 Kodlama